public interface ImageCaptchaApplication
ApiResponse<ImageCaptchaVO> generateCaptcha()
ApiResponse<ImageCaptchaVO> generateCaptcha(String type)
type - type类型ApiResponse<ImageCaptchaVO> generateCaptcha(CaptchaImageType captchaImageType)
captchaImageType - 要生成webp还是jpg类型的图片ApiResponse<ImageCaptchaVO> generateCaptcha(String type, CaptchaImageType captchaImageType)
type - typecaptchaImageType - CaptchaImageTypeApiResponse<ImageCaptchaVO> generateCaptcha(GenerateParam param)
param - paramApiResponse<?> matching(String id, MatchParam matchParam)
id - 验证码的IDmatchParam - 匹配数据,包含鼠标轨迹,设备信息等ApiResponse<?> matching(String id, ImageCaptchaTrack track)
matching(String, MatchParam)id - 验证码的IDtrack - 轨迹数据@Deprecated boolean matching(String id, Float percentage)
matching(String, MatchParam)id - idpercentage - 百分比数据ImageCaptchaResourceManager getImageCaptchaResourceManager()
void setImageCaptchaValidator(ImageCaptchaValidator imageCaptchaValidator)
imageCaptchaValidator - imageCaptchaValidatorvoid setImageCaptchaGenerator(ImageCaptchaGenerator imageCaptchaGenerator)
imageCaptchaGenerator - SliderCaptchaGeneratorCaptchaInterceptor getCaptchaInterceptor()
void setCaptchaInterceptor(CaptchaInterceptor captchaInterceptor)
captchaInterceptor - captchaInterceptorvoid setCacheStore(CacheStore cacheStore)
cacheStore - cacheStoreImageCaptchaValidator getImageCaptchaValidator()
ImageCaptchaGenerator getImageCaptchaGenerator()
CacheStore getCacheStore()
Copyright © 2025. All rights reserved.